− | Prosthetic legs replace the user's [[Table of Human Body Parts|entire organic leg]]. They are universal and can be installed on either the left or right side. The prosthetic leg has a part efficiency of 85%. This partially replaces the functionality of a normal leg - when coupled with the leg body part having a [[Moving]] importance of 50%, it results in restoring 42.5% [[moving]] per missing leg replaced, or a loss of 7.5% when replacing a healthy leg. | + | Prosthetic legs replace the user's [[Table of Human Body Parts|entire organic leg]]. They are universal and can be installed on either the left or right side. The prosthetic leg has a part efficiency of 85%. This partially replaces the functionality of a normal leg - when coupled with the leg body part having a [[Moving]] importance of 50%, it results in restoring 42.5% [[moving]] per missing leg replaced, or a loss of 7.5% when replacing a healthy leg.
